- 0
- 0
- 约4.75千字
- 约 9页
- 2026-02-25 发布于中国
- 举报
计算机四级数据库工程师2025年真题试卷100题(含ER图解析)
姓名:__________考号:__________
题号
一
二
三
四
五
总分
评分
一、单选题(共10题)
1.关系数据库中,下列哪种操作属于集合操作?()
A.插入记录
B.更新记录
C.删除记录
D.选择记录
2.在数据库规范化理论中,第一范式(1NF)的约束条件是?()
A.每个属性都不可再分
B.每个表只有一个主键
C.每个非主属性完全依赖于主键
D.每个表都有自增主键
3.SQL语言中,用于创建表的命令是?()
A.CREATEVIEW
B.CREATEINDEX
C.CREATETABLE
D.CREATEPROCEDURE
4.在关系数据库中,实体型之间的关系不包括?()
A.识别关系
B.依赖关系
C.关联关系
D.函数关系
5.数据库系统中,下列哪个组件负责处理事务的提交和回滚?()
A.索引
B.事务管理器
C.数据库引擎
D.存储过程
6.ER图中的实体类型用以下哪种图形表示?()
A.矩形
B.菱形
C.椭圆
D.线条
7.数据库的完整性与哪些因素相关?()
A.数据库设计
B.硬件配置
C.系统软件
D.以上都是
8.SQL语言中,用于删除表结构的命令是?()
A.DROPTABLE
B.DELETEFROM
C.TRUNCATETABLE
D.ALTERTABLE
9.数据库中的视图可以包含哪些类型的SQL语句?()
A.SELECT,INSERT,UPDATE,DELETE
B.SELECT,CREATE,ALTER,DROP
C.CREATE,INSERT,UPDATE,DELETE
D.SELECT,CREATE,ALTER,DROP
10.在数据库中,下列哪种关系被称为“一对多”关系?()
A.实体间一对一关系
B.实体间一对多关系
C.属性间一对一关系
D.属性间一对多关系
二、多选题(共5题)
11.以下哪些是数据库设计规范化的目的?()
A.提高数据的一致性
B.减少数据冗余
C.提高查询效率
D.保证数据完整性
12.在ER图中,以下哪些元素表示实体?()
A.矩形
B.菱形
C.椭圆
D.线条
13.以下哪些是数据库事务的ACID特性?()
A.原子性(Atomicity)
B.一致性(Consistency)
C.可串行化(Serializability)
D.可恢复性(Durability)
14.在关系数据库中,以下哪些操作会导致数据冗余?()
A.插入记录
B.更新记录
C.删除记录
D.视图查询
15.以下哪些是数据库完整性约束?()
A.主键约束
B.外键约束
C.非空约束
D.检查约束
三、填空题(共5题)
16.在数据库规范化理论中,如果一个关系模式中的所有属性都是不可再分的,那么它至少满足第一范式(1NF)。
17.在ER图中,实体之间的联系可以分为一对一、一对多和多对多三种类型。
18.SQL语言中,用于删除表中所有记录并重置表结构的命令是TRUNCATETABLE。
19.在数据库设计中,为了确保数据的一致性,通常会使用事务来处理多个操作的集合。
20.在数据库查询中,使用SELECT语句可以指定查询结果中需要显示的列,格式为SELECT列名FROM表名。
四、判断题(共5题)
21.在数据库设计中,第三范式(3NF)要求所有非主属性都完全依赖于主键。()
A.正确B.错误
22.在SQL语言中,UPDATE语句只能更新表中已经存在的记录。()
A.正确B.错误
23.ER图中的实体和联系都必须有一个名称。()
A.正确B.错误
24.在数据库事务中,只要有一个操作失败,整个事务就会回滚。()
A.正确B.错误
25.视图是一种虚拟表,它可以从一个或多个基本表的数据中生成。()
A.正确B.错误
五、简单题(共5题)
26.请解释数据库规范化理论中的第一范式(1NF)和第二范式(2NF)的区别。
27.在数据库设计中,为什么要使用索引?
28.请简述数据库事务的ACID特性。
29.如何判断一个关系模式是否符合第三范式(3N
原创力文档

文档评论(0)